Judgment text excerpt
The Supreme Court upheld the conviction of the appellants under Section 302 IPC read with Section 34 IPC for the murder of Biti Murmu, finding that the evidence presented by PW-8 was credible and sufficient to establish the culpability of the accused. The Court clarified the distinction between culpable homicide and murder, emphasizing that not all culpable homicides qualify as murder under Section 300 IPC. The appeal against the High Court's decision was dismissed, affirming the life sentences imposed by the trial court.
